What are the key features of PIC12C509A-04I/SM?
- 8-bit PIC12 OTP microcontroller with 1 KB one-time-programmable program memory and 4 MHz maximum clock for cost-optimized fixed-function embedded designs
- 6 configurable I/O pins with integrated pull-up resistors, reducing external component count in simple control and sequencing applications
- Internal 4 MHz RC oscillator option eliminates external crystal cost, enabling minimal-component solutions in SOIC-8 SMD package operating from 2.5 V to 5.5 V
What is PIC12C509A-04I/SM used for?
The PIC12C509A-04I/SM is suited for simple, fixed-function control tasks such as appliance power-on sequencing, LED dimming controllers, and low-cost consumer product timers where the code does not need to change after programming. Its 1 KB OTP memory and internal oscillator allow a complete controller solution with fewer than 5 external components. The SOIC-8 SMD package supports automated assembly for high-volume cost-sensitive products.

Frequently Asked Questions
What is the maximum clock frequency and supply voltage range for the PIC12C509A-04I/SM in a battery-powered appliance design?
The PIC12C509A-04I/SM runs at up to 4 MHz and accepts a supply voltage from 2.5 V to 5.5 V. This makes it compatible with two-cell alkaline battery packs or regulated 3.3 V and 5 V rails. At lower frequencies enabled by the internal RC oscillator, the device draws minimal standby current, helping extend battery life in portable appliance control applications.
Since PIC12C509A-04I/SM uses OTP memory, when should a designer choose it over a flash-based PIC12F508 for a production run?
OTP parts like PIC12C509A-04I/SM are optimal when firmware is finalized and the production volume is high enough to justify non-reprogrammable devices, typically thousands of units where per-unit cost savings outweigh development flexibility. The PIC12F508 offers flash reprogrammability for prototyping and small runs, but the OTP device provides lower unit cost. Both share a similar 1 KB code space and 4 MHz maximum clock, so the choice is purely economic above roughly 5000 units.
How many I/O pins are available on PIC12C509A-04I/SM, and what peripherals are integrated to minimize external component count?
The PIC12C509A-04I/SM provides 6 configurable I/O pins in the 8-pin SOIC-8 (SOIJ-8) package, with individual software-configurable input/output direction per pin. Internal weak pull-up resistors on input pins eliminate external pull-up resistors, and the integrated 4 MHz RC oscillator removes the need for a crystal or external clock source. There is no ADC, so analog inputs require external conditioning, but for simple digital control the part needs only a bypass capacitor to operate.
